Mike's IMTX Plan

Hi Rich, 18-year vet with a chronic 10:30-45 IM "problem" (consistent 1:00, 5:40, 3:50).  I can eke a few seconds out of my swim and run, but it's the bike where I see big opportunity.  Work obligations and climate have always limited bike training to a few hours/wk, mostly on a trainer, with a few long rides crammed at the end.  Now in Florida with a 9-6, no-travel job, the bike excuses have disappeared.  For IMTX, I plan on a Big Bike Week 12 weeks out (unless that's too close to race day?) and hopefully the EN camp 8 weeks out.  Otherwise, with 27 weeks at my disposal, I have time for 6-8 weeks of Bike Focus or Get Faster, then 20 weeks of IM.  Or does it make more sense to do 6 weeks of Bike Focus, 8 of Get Faster, then final 12 of the IM schedule? Or some other approach that can help me address my problem?  Thanks so much.  Mike
